Abstract
We investigate the convergence properties of the forgetting factor RLS algorithm in a stationary data environment, Using the settling time a s our performance measure, we show that the algorithm exhibits a varia ble performance that depends on the particular combination of the init ialization and noise level. Specifically when the observation noise le vel is low (high SNR) RLS, when initialized with a matrix of small nor m, it has an exceptionally fast convergence, Convergence speed decreas es as we increase the norm of the initialization matrix, In a medium S NR environment, the optimum convergence speed of the algorithm is redu ced as compared with the previous case; however, RLS becomes more inse nsitive to initialization, Finally, in a low SNR environment, we show that it is preferable to initialize the algorithm with a matrix of lar ge norm.
